About Paris (Tennessee)
Paris is the county seat of Henry County, Tennessee. It is near the shore ofKentucky Lakeand theLand Between the Lakes National Recreation Area. Between about 1970 and 1990, Paris became the center of the Old Beachy Amish. Beachy Amish from different regions moved there to maintain their traditional ways. Because of internal conflicts, most Old Beachy Amish left the region in the early 1990s and had completely vacated it by 2000. Local companies manufacture brakes, small electric motors, aftermarket auto parts, metal doors, rubber parts and school laboratory furniture.
